Why does this have to go to BOT?

Doesn't the AD have the ability to schedule games?

It’s a State contract. AD can negotiate the business terms but prior to execution it has to be reviewed/approved by the UConn General Counsel (and the the State AG office depending on contract value amount) and approved by the BOT prior to execution by the President (or authorized signatory)
